Dewatering well water level automatic stabilizing system
The invention relates to a dewatering well water level automatic stabilizing system. The system comprises a throw-in type liquid level meter, a water pump, an ultrasonic flowmeter, a control panel and a neural network algorithm running in a big data center, wherein the throw-in type liquid level meter and the water pump are arranged in a dewatering well, the ultrasonic flow meter is installed on the outer side of a pipeline of the water pump and used for monitoring working parameters of the water pump, the control panel is in signal connection with the big data center to form data interaction, the control panel inputs the working parameters, actually measured by the ultrasonic flow meter, of the water pump and a measurement result of the throw-in type liquid level meter into a neural network algorithm, the neural network algorithm outputs calculated working parameters of the water pump according to historical water level data, and the control panel controls the working state of the water pump according to output connection of the neural network algorithm. The system has the advantages that the stability of the water level in the dewatering well is guaranteed, the problems of insufficient dewatering and excessive dewatering are avoided, and then foundation pit excavation difficulty caused by insufficient dewatering and foundation pit deformation caused by excessive dewatering are avoided.
